Nijverheid is a neighbourhood with a cosy, friendly feel, according to the two residents who reviewed it. One resident says: "I grew up here. Always found it a nice neighbourhood with lovely people. De Nijverheid has beautiful houses. I never felt unsafe here. I also went to school on De Nijverheid. Had a good time there. Personally, I have nothing bad to say about the neighbourhood." Another adds: "Good contacts, no noise." The neighbourhood scores an average of 8.32 out of 10. It's a mixed area, with many single-person households and a good share of families, and the housing stock is mostly single-family homes. For more on the area, see the Nijverheid neighbourhood.
For daily shopping, the nearest supermarket is a PLUS, just around the corner, with an Albert Heijn, Aldi and Jumbo all within a ten-minute walk. For schools, the closest primary school is KBS de Wheele, about 3.7 km away, and there are several others within a short drive. The train station is about 700 metres away, making commutes easy. Auto-translated to English by AInormal neighbourhood but very dependent on exactly where you are. the closer to the railway, the worse it gets. waste nuisance around the Aldi is excessive and really needs attention. speeding on the Mozartlaan, Paganinistraat, Oude Postweg, Jozef Haydnlaan is also significant. speeding is too easy and it's unclear what the maximum speed is. small gardens and green strips also need attention. where the streets are swept regularly (plus point), the gardens are maintained once a year. I feel safe enough, although it's not always great, loud foreign voices, groups of men and overdue maintenance on sometimes entire blocks.
